<< Click to Display Table of Contents >> 调度任务配置 |
用户可对调度任务进行一些属性配置。
❖任务计划服务的启动状态
在 bi.properties 文件中配置属性:scheduler.init.start=xxx, 其中 xxx 可以是 true 或者 false,默认值是true。当值为 true 时,任务计划服务开启;当值为 false 时,任务计划服务关闭。
❖多任务的执行方式
在 bi.properties 文件中配置属性:sched.job.parallel=xxx, 其中 xxx 可以是 true 或者 false,默认值是true。当值为 true 时,作业中的多任务并行执行;当值为 false 时,作业中的多任务串行执行。
❖前序作业失败后续作业运行状态
在 bi.properties 文件中配置属性:sched.afterjob.execute=xxx, 其中 xxx 可以是 true 或者 false,默认值是 false。当值为 true 时,前序作业运行失败,后续作业运行;当值为 false 时,前序作业运行失败,后续作业不运行。
❖输出文件日期格式
在 bi.properties 文件中配置属性:export.append.ts.format=xxx, 其中 xxx 可以是 yyyyMMdd,yyyyMMddHHmmss,默认是 yyyyMMdd( 年月日 )。
同理可以配置发送邮件附件的日期格式:mail.append.ts.format=yyyyMMdd。
❖发送邮件重发机制
在 bi.properties 文件中配置属性:mail.repeat=xxx,其中 xxx 可以是 true 或者 false,默认是 true。当值为 true 时,如果网络环境不好,发送邮件任务会重发三次;当值为 false 时,不进行重发。
❖作业按分组限制创建数和并发数
在 bi.properties文件中配置属性:job.concurrency.limit=xxx,其中 xxx 可以是 true 或者 false,默认值是 false。当值为true时,在认证授权->分组管理->分组信息中会增加“作业数量限制”属性,如下图:
给组设置作业数量限制后,组内用户创建作业的数量和运行作业的数量不能超过该数量。
➢注意:
1.能设置的作业数量限制数小于当前节点的license中的CPU数;
2.admin和admin_role用户没有作业数量限制;
3.一个用户在多个分组中时,该用户的作业数量限制为所有分组中设置的最小的作业数量限制;
4.一个用户在多级组下时,若当前分组设置了作业数量限制,则该用户的作业数量限制为当前分组设置的作业数量限制;若当前分组没有设置作业数量限制,则该用户的作业数量限制继承相邻上级分组的作业数量限制;
5.用户移动分组后,会保留用户已创建的作业,但运行的作业数受当前分组的作业数量限制。